Caulfield Real Estate

The median home value in Caulfield, MO is $89,850. This is lower than the county median home value of $119,500. The national median home value is $219,700. The average price of homes sold in Caulfield, MO is $89,850. Approximately 48.59% of Caulfield homes are owned, compared to 29.84% rented, while 21.57% are vacant. Caulfield, Missouri has a population of 1,556. Caulfield is less family-centric than the surrounding county with 26.52%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 29.33%.

The median household income in Caulfield, Missouri is $35,708. The median household income for the surrounding county is $34,984 compared to the national median of $57,652. The median age of people living in Caulfield is 47.9 years.

Caulfield Weather

The average high temperature in July is 88.1 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 21.4 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 45.5 inches per year, with 7.6 inches of snow per year.
